Handlettering for Scrapookers, Journalers and Crafters (self-paced)

Add your own personality to your artistic creations with hand-lettering. In this 6-lesson online workshop, I’ll show you  how to use simple tools to create outstanding hand-lettered titles, embellishments, and word-art. We’ll begin with using base alphabets and then add decorative detail and we’ll even create our own display fonts.

Hand Lettering for Scrapbookers, Journalers and Crafters includes:

  • basic hand-lettering techniques
  • simple instructions and practical lettering advice
  • 10 full alphabets to copy and/or trace
  • how-tos for stroked letters as well as outlined and filled forms
  • ideas for color, fill, and creative add-ons
  • exposure to letter forms and add-ons that can convey a variety of tones, from whimsy to formality
  • sample artwork to inspire your own projects
